When you have discovered a wounded chicken, it’s important to assess the damage and clean the area. But you must stop any active bleeding first. Some wounds, like combs, waddles, and toenails, will bleed far more than others. I use Kwik Stop to stop the bleeding but any styptic powder will work.

STOP ANY BLEEDING Using a clean towel, gauze or paper towel, apply gentle, but firm pressure to an actively bleeding injury until it stops. Wearing vinyl gloves is a good idea when treating wounds. Blood stop powder can be applied to superficial wounds after active bleeding has been controlled.

WebJan 18, 2016 · Control Bleeding. Whenever possible, wear gloves when treating a bleeding or wounded chicken. With a clean towel, gauze or paper towel, apply gentle, firm, even pressure to the injury until bleeding stops. Apply styptic powder to superficial wounds and hold in place until bleeding stops.

WebJul 26, 2024 · If you find your chicken bleeding from the mouth, it’s either an injury or a disease. Injuries can be self-inflicted or caused by beak-trimming. In the case of a disease, the blood can come from a respiratory infection affecting the lungs, a ruptured blood vessel, a bleeding ulcer, or a heart condition.
